Output c22f66fa2c161f63c3bf6a010841b84f3613d896b75df7e13561f0331df9c006:1

value
149099543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a31264a6815ca8415a5de481029a4d2627c56fe OP_EQUAL
address
39uucnEU5c7uQcnWYrAHUML1Kdae5mkRPs
transaction
c22f66fa2c161f63c3bf6a010841b84f3613d896b75df7e13561f0331df9c006
confirmations
347796
spent
true